The annual Navratri Festival for 2023 is set to kick off today and will be inaugurated by Chief Minister Bhupendra Patel. 

Hosted at the Gujarat University ground, this nine-day festival, organised by the state’s Tourism Department, will conclude on Oct 23.

Navratri Festival 2023 to commence today

The opening ceremony, scheduled to commence at 8.30 p.m., will be attended by Gujarat chief minister Bhupendra Patel and will feature a Maha Aarti centred around the theme along with multimedia cultural programmes.

The festivities will include a state-level garba competition, set to begin today and run through the entire duration, starting each evening at 6 p.m., as announced by the authorities.

Those not partaking in the competition can play the traditional Sheri Garba, happening daily from 9 p.m. to midnight.

Health and personal safety a priority

In Vadodara, to enhance women’s safety, 22 units of the ‘She Team’ from Vadodara city police will disguise themselves as garba players on the ground.

In anticipation of medical emergencies, particularly cardiac issues, large organisers with more than 20,000 daily registered participants have taken proactive measures.

They have set up emergency exits, multiple makeshift hospitals at entry points, and panels of doctors at the venue to ensure timely medical attention can be provided when needed. Similar precautions have been taken in Ahmedabad and Rajkot.
